How to Find the Templar Kimura Kei in Assassin’s Creed Shadows
Your first clue to Kimura Kei's whereabouts comes from a ronin contact in Kii. Locate him at the inn in Takahara Village along the central Nakahechi Route. If pinpointing his location proves challenging, deploy Scouts to assist. The inn will be easily identifiable by green flags and a nearby cherry blossom tree. Inside, you'll meet a ronin adorned in Oda Clan attire. Engage in conversation, and he'll direct you to find a recruiter named Kumabe Ujiie.
Where to Find Kumabe Ujiie
Kumabe Ujiie awaits in northern Kii, specifically at a cemetery in Koyasan, northeast of Kongobuji Temple. He'll be accompanied by his ronin escort, but there's no need for confrontation. Approach him and select the "I seek guidance" dialogue option. Follow him, and he'll eventually disclose Kimura Kei's location.
How and Where to Assassinate Kimura Kei
Kimura Kei's Training Grounds are situated in the southwest part of Kii, just north of the shore, midway between Sazae Oni Shores and Nakahechi Route. Upon arrival, blend in with the students to reach Kimura Kei. He'll recognize Yasuke and order his students to attack. Prepare for a fierce battle as you'll be surrounded by ronin. Equip your highest-level armor and weapons, and don't forget to utilize the strategically placed explosive red barrels to clear groups of enemies.
The confrontation with Kimura Kei escalates into a multi-phase boss fight, where stealth assassination is not an option. Equip armor with engravings that enhance your ability to parry unblockable attacks, as Kimura Kei will frequently use them. In the first phase, he wields a standard Katana; parry his attacks to expose vulnerabilities and use posture attacks to break his armor. As the fight progresses to the second phase, he switches to a Long Katana alongside his standard Katana, increasing the frequency of unblockable attacks. Focus on dodging and striking when opportunities arise.
Once Kimura Kei's health drops to about half, the battle shifts outdoors. Here, his attacks become even more lethal. Dodge frequently and maintain distance when necessary. Employing a bow or teppo for ranged attacks can be highly effective.
Every Reward for Killing Kimura Kei in Assassin’s Creed Shadows
Upon defeating Kimura Kei, you'll be rewarded with 3,000 XP, some Mon, and the Templar-themed Destroyer Samurai Armor and Helmet. The armor features an engraving that reduces the impact of enemy attacks, while the helmet boosts Yasuke's damage by 10% for every 10% of his health missing.
How to Find the Silver Queen in Assassin’s Creed Shadows
After defeating the Shinbakufu, the Silver Queen becomes the next target on the Templar Board, aiding the Portuguese in their plundering of Tamba. To reach her, you'll need to gather information from various contacts, starting with a spy.
Where to Find and Talk to The Spy
The spy, crucial for information on the Silver Queen, is located in Southeast Tamba within the Silver Lands. Find him sitting on a rug under a small structure near a wooden cart and crates. Engage in conversation, and he'll reveal the Silver Queen's location.
Where to Meet the Silver Queen
The Silver Queen can be found in the town of Tada, just northeast of Tada Kakurega. She'll be conversing with Portuguese soldiers. Approach and talk to her, then follow her to her house for tea. Be cautious, as you'll wake up in Tada Silver Mine after being drugged.
How to Escape from Tada Silver Mine
Upon waking in a locked room within Tada Silver Mine, break the door by sprinting into it. After dealing with the guards, you can choose to fight or sneak your way out. Opting for stealth is quicker and less risky. Head southwest out of the mine, eliminating any enemies in your path.
How to Locate Akechi Mitsuyoshi
The Silver Queen requires Yasuke's assistance in rescuing her brother, Akechi Mitsuyoshi, in exchange for information on Yasuke's true target. After escaping Tada Silver Mine, head north to Kameyama Castle. If you need supplies, stop at the Kakurega just north of Senneji Temple in Kameyama.
Activate Pathfinder and navigate through Kameyama Castle, eliminating guards as you follow the suggested path. Inside the living quarters, you'll find a bleeding servant who provides a key to the castle's Tenshu.
How to Free Akechi Mitsuyoshi and Retrieve His Katana
With the key in hand, enter the main castle building beneath the Viewpoint and unlock the door to Akechi Mitsuyoshi's cell. Follow him as he escapes, using your bow or teppo to neutralize distant threats. After his escape, return to the castle to confront Baltazar and retrieve Akechi Mitsuyoshi's Katana. Defeat Baltazar and his surrounding soldiers using abilities and posture attacks to break his guard and deal significant damage.
Once you've secured the Katana, head north to Atago Shrine. There, converse with Akechi Mitsuyoshi and follow him to the Shrine to receive the location of your next target.
How to Find and Assassinate Nuno Caro
Yasuke's final target, Nuno Caro, is preparing to leave Japan and can be found at Takeda Castle in Western Tamba. The castle, perched high on a mountain, is accessible via a winding road. Use Pathfinder to find the most direct route.
Takeda Castle is heavily guarded with numerous enemies and alarm bells. Since stealth is less viable for Yasuke, disable the alarm bells with your bow or teppo. As you ascend, you'll reach a set of double doors leading to Nuno Caro. Clear out his men as you climb, culminating in a boss fight at the castle's summit.
Nuno Caro fights with a sword and pistol, using a combo of up to four swipes and a red-glowing pistol shot that you must dodge. Use Abilities to inflict high damage and create vulnerabilities, then attack in cycles until he's defeated. With Nuno Caro's demise, the Templar Hunt Objective Board is completed.
